About Fallon Health:Fallon Health is a mission-driven not-for-profit health care services organization based in Worcester, Massachusetts. For 45 years we have been improving health and inspiring hope in the communities we serve. Committed to caring for those who need us most, we pride ourselves on providing equitable access to coordinated, integrated care for our members with a special focus on those who qualify for Medicare and Medicaid. We also serve as a provider of care through our Program of All-Inclusive Care for the Elderly (PACE). Dedicated to delivering high quality health care, we are continually rated among the nation’s top health plans for member experience and service and clinical quality.
Brief Summary of Purpose:
Information Management Analyst I is a key contributor to the success of the Business Intelligence & Analytics team. You will work with business partners/stakeholders to gather, analyze and clearly document business requirements. Information Management Analyst I completes activities related to the development and support of business data management solutions on small to medium projects. You will be the liaison between the business users and the BI Team and other IT resources, responsible for ensuring business and data requirements are defined, documented and translated into technical requirements to facilitate the design/build and delivery of business intelligence solutions.
